The Gluten-Free Doctor, Dr. Wangen, Stops by Colorado

April 6, 2011

We are a little late getting up this post, but wanted to give a shout-out to Dr. Stephen Wangen.  We were lucky enough to get the chance to have breakfast with the doctor when he was in town last month to speak at a presentation organized by the Denver CSA Chapter.  It was a fun filled morning of chatting with  Dr. Wangen, catching up with our GF blogger friends, and thoroughly enjoying the gluten-free breakfast cooked up by Snooze AM Eatery in Denver. Their gluten-free pancakes were a hit across the table!

Dr. Wangen is a licensed and board certified physician specializing in digestive disorders and food allergies. He is the author of “Healthier Without Wheat: A New Understanding of Wheat Allergies, Celiac Disease, and Non-Celiac Gluten Intolerance”. He has first-hand experience with his area of expertise, having been diagnosed with IBS and later a gluten intolerance in 1996 as well as a dairy allergy.  We picked his brain on helpful tips for those living with celiac disease and those just beginning their  gluten-free journey.  Check out Dr. Wangen’s blog for great information and help for gluten-free living.

The morning was made complete by the other participants at the gluten-free meeting- Dee Valdez from Gluten Free Dee, Rich Schneider from Sandwich Petals, Jim from Happy Gluten Free, Erin from King Sooper’s, and Deby’s Gluten Free showed up with gluten-free muffins.
